'Name Kwara Govt House after Saraki'

Date: 2012-11-28

A former Commissioner for Special Duties in Kwara state, Alhaji Razaq Lawal and a member of the state House of Assembly, Hon Kamaldeen Ajibade, have suggested the naming of Kwara State Government House after the late Second Republic Senate Leader, Dr Olusola Saraki.

Lawal, in an interview with newsmen in Ilorin, said that "the late Baba Saraki was the true and authentic landlord of Kwara Government House and he always passed the key to whoever he wishes through the help of Almighty Allah.

"He was instrumental to the elections of all former civilian governors of the state, namely Alhaji Adamu Attah, Chief Cornelius Adebayo,Alhaji Sha'aba Lafiagi and Dr Bukola Saraki. Therefore, no one but the late Saraki deserves to be so immortalised."

Also, Hon Ajibade argued that no governor in a democratic dispensation got elected without the input of the late Saraki.

He added, "I heard National Assembly calling for the naming of Ilorin International airport after him. I totally disagree with this. Going by history, there is hardly any governor in a democratic dispensation that got to power without Saraki's support.

"Therefore that seat of government should be named after him because he deserves more than that for his generosity".

The lawmaker added that, "the cream of those who have been visiting the state since his death show that his demise was a great loss to the entire Nigerian nation".
